I'm actually using it in my NA H22 accord...all you need is an OBD 1 ECU either the P72(GSR) P28(SI/EX) or the PO6(VX/DX) and have it chiped with chrome pro..its the same thing and it's free you can tune all aspects of A/F, vtec, timing, blah blah blah....have it tuned on the dyno than take it driving with the Ostrige???(spelling) and have it street tuned youll be very pleased but you wont need that space in your dashboard as this is all controlled via the ECU

The benifits are tremondus!!! as with the VAFC hack you can only tune for 1 setting be it Partial throttle or full.....POINT BLANK FMU and VAFCs break motors its all in the tune...I'd like to hear more details of the setup and if you have a myspace join this group second biggest Accord Forum on Myspace lota turbo H22 and F22 accords in the group check it out!

cromePro is NOT free. Now, you can get the crack for it, but thats just downright low.

if you're a true enthusiast just buy the damn program and give back for all the time the guy has put into making it what it is. its tons better than uberdata and pretty comparable to hondata.

o, and if you didnt notice already, its CROME, no H. you obviously dont know what you are talking about and go by word of mouth. what kind of person doesnt know the names of the products their car runs? also, its OSTRICH.

vafcs and fmu's dont break motors, their user do. how do you think most other non honda turbo setups run? they dont have the ecu development we do, so they run hacks and whatnot. it can be tuned so it runs well enough, not great like with a stand alone, but well enough and will not blow up.
